About the NVIDIA GeForce GTX 980 Ti GPU

The NVIDIA GeForce GTX 980 Ti is an end-of-life desktop graphics card that released in Q2 2015 with a MSRP of $649. It is built on the Maxwell 2.0 GPU microarchitecture (codename GM200) and is manufactured on a 28 nm process.

Memory

The GTX 980 Ti has 6 GB of GDDR5 memory, with a 1,753 MHz memory clock and a 384 bit interface. This gives it a memory bandwidth of 336.6 Gb/s, which affects how fast it can transfer data to and from memory. GPU memory stores temporary data that helps the GPU with complex math and graphics operations. More memory is generally better, as not having enough can cause performance bottlenecks.

Cores and Clock Speeds

The GTX 980 Ti includes 2,816 CUDA cores, the processing units for handling parallel computing tasks. The GPU operates at a core clock speed of 1,000 MHz and can dynamically boost its clock speed up to 1,076 MHz. Complementing the processing units are 176 texture mapping units (TMUs) for efficient texture filtering and 96 render output units (ROPs) for pixel processing.

Compatibility & Power Consumption

The GTX 980 Ti occupies 2 PCIe expansion slots. It supports DVI, HDMI 2.0, DisplayPort 1.2 display connections. NVIDIA recommends a power supply of at least 600 W to handle the GPU's thermal design power (TDP) of 250 W.

About the NVIDIA GeForce RTX 3080 Ti GPU

The NVIDIA GeForce RTX 3080 Ti is a desktop graphics card that launched in Q2 2021 with a MSRP of $1,199. It is built on the Ampere GPU microarchitecture (codename GA102) and is manufactured on a 8 nm process.

Memory

The RTX 3080 Ti has 12 GB of GDDR6X memory, with a 1,188 MHz memory clock and a 384 bit interface. This gives it a memory bandwidth of 912.4 Gb/s, which affects how fast it can transfer data to and from memory. GPU memory stores temporary data that helps the GPU with complex math and graphics operations. More memory is generally better, as not having enough can cause performance bottlenecks.

Cores and Clock Speeds

The RTX 3080 Ti includes 10,240 CUDA cores, the processing units for handling parallel computing tasks. The GPU operates at a core clock speed of 1,365 MHz and can dynamically boost its clock speed up to 1,665 MHz. Complementing the processing units are 320 texture mapping units (TMUs) for efficient texture filtering and 112 render output units (ROPs) for pixel processing. Additionally, the GPU features 320 tensor cores optimized for AI-accelerated workloads and 80 RT cores dedicated to real-time ray tracing calculations.

Compatibility & Power Consumption

The RTX 3080 Ti occupies 2 PCIe expansion slots. It supports HDMI 2.1, DisplayPort 1.4a display connections. NVIDIA recommends a power supply of at least 750 W to handle the GPU's thermal design power (TDP) of 350 W.
